文章详情页
mysql - 怎么让java项目的sql兼容多个多种数据库的sql语法?
问题描述
Java项目中的sql语句怎么兼容多种数据库。项目属于产品类,不确认用户使用哪种数据库。我们开发时使用的是db2,但是如果遇到oracle数据库的话,sql会失效,不知道怎么实现兼容多个数据库。比如oracle,MySQL,SQL server,db2等。
问题解答
回答1:可以试试使用支持多种方言的ORM框架。
回答2:orm不就是解决这个问题的么,根据配置的数据库方言执行不同的sql,jpa,hibernate
相关文章:
1. mysql - 数据库建字段,默认值空和empty string有什么区别 1102. angular.js - 在ionic下,利用javascript导入百度地图,pc端可以显示,移动端无法显示3. HTML5禁止img预览该怎么解决?4. javascript - 关于js原生事件的绑定与解除绑定5. mybatis - Java关于Mysql的随机id生成6. javascript - 手机点击input时,button会被顶上去?求解决!!!7. Java ImageIO.read(getClass()。getResource())返回null8. python3 脚本调用shell 指令如何获得返回值9. dologin说是没有定义10. javascript - 有没有iOS微信中可以在背景播放视频的方法?
排行榜